Java 将Excel转为XML
可扩展标记语言(XML)文件是一种标准的文本文件,它使用特定的标记来描述文档的结构以及其他特性。通常,我们可以通过格式转换的方式来得到XML格式的文件。本文,将通过Java代码介绍如何实现由Excel到XML格式的转换。
导入Jar
在程序中引入 Free Spire.XLS for Java 中的 Spire.Xls.jar 文件(该文件在lib文件夹下);如果需要通过 Maven下载导入,可进行如下配置pom.xml:
<repositories> <repository> <id>com.e-iceblueid> <url>https://repo.e-iceblue.cn/repository/maven-public/url> repository> repositories> <dependencies> <dependency> <groupId>e-icebluegroupId> <artifactId>spire.xls.freeartifactId> <version>5.1.0version> dependency> dependencies>
将Excel转为XML
转换时,只需要三行代码即可实现,即:
- 创建Workbook类的对象,并通过Workbook.loadFromFile()方法加载Excel文档。
- 调用Workbook.saveAsXml()方法保存为XML文件到指定路径。
Java
import com.spire.xls.*; public class ExcelToXML { public static void main(String[] args) { //创建Workbook类的对象 Workbook wb = new Workbook(); //加载Excel文档 wb.loadFromFile("test.xlsx"); //保存为XML文件 wb.saveAsXml("result.xml"); } }
转换结果:
推荐阅读:
—END—